Customer operations refer to customer-centric business functions like sales and service which extend support to the customer. These were earlier perceived to be a cost center, but that notion has changed over the past decade. Customer operations are now regarded as the Swiss army knife of business operations. This is largely due to the fact that it supports several core business functions such as Sales, Marketing, Branding, and Product Development.
